Microaggressions are subtle, often unintentional, discriminatory remarks or behaviours that can create an uncomfortable and exclusionary work environment.

They might seem harmless to some, but their cumulative impact can be profoundly damaging, contributing to feelings of isolation, stress, and decreased morale.
